What is a Diesel Injector pump?

A diesel injector pump is a mechanical device that is used to deliver highly pressurized fuel to the engine cylinders. It is responsible for maintaining the correct timing and amount of fuel delivery to the engine. In order to function properly, the injector pump must be synchronized with the engine crankshaft.

What are the Benefits of a Diesel Injector Pump?

Diesel injector pumps are one of the most important components in a diesel engine. They are responsible for delivering the precise amount of fuel to the engine cylinders at the right time. This ensures that the engine runs smoothly and efficiently.

There are several benefits of using a diesel injector pump:

1. Improved Fuel Efficiency: Diesel injector pumps help to improve the fuel efficiency of an engine by delivering the precise amount of fuel needed for combustion. This results in less fuel being wasted and improved overall mileage.

2. Enhanced Engine Performance: By ensuring that the correct amount of fuel is injected into each cylinder, diesel injector pumps help to enhance engine performance. This leads to increased power and torque, as well as reduced emissions.

3. Greater Durability: Diesel injector pumps are built to withstand high temperatures and pressures, meaning they tend to be more durable than other types offuel injection systems. This increases the lifespan of an engine and reduces maintenance costs.
